Abstract
The utility model discloses a reinforcing apparatus of narrow coal column between tunnel, narrow coal column top is equipped with the roof, and the below is equipped with the bottom plate, reinforcing apparatus includes the anchor rope and protects table component board, the anchor eye has been seted up on the narrow coal column, protecting table member board and setting up in narrow coal column both sides, the anchor rope runs through the anchor eye setting, and anchor rope both ends salient is in protecting table member board, and the anchor rope both ends add is equipped with the cydariform tray, and it is fixed that the cydariform tray passes through the rigging. The utility model discloses simple structure, simple to operate, quick struts reliable, save material, improvement resource extraction rate. Reinforcing apparatus of narrow coal column between tunnel can guarantee that the coal column is kept perfectly, does not take place to warp the phenomenon of collapsing under great roof pressure and strong exploitation disturbance.

Technical field
This utility model relates to a kind of Roadway Support Technology field, and specific design one is applied between tunnel to stay thin coal pillar fast reinforcing.
Background technology
Along with coal mining intensity increases, progressively being developed to deep by superficial part, deep mining is characterized by that crustal stress is high, structure complexity, and Surrounding Rock Strength is low, and the requirement that Drift stability is controlled is more and more higher.Gob side entry retaining, gob side entry driving, upper and lower intermountain are generally stayed and are set 5m-10m coal column protection tunnel; but because mine pressure is big; strong exploitation disturbance; the factors such as coal and rock self-strength is low affect; coal column often deforms-unstability-destruction; cause difficulty to Safety of Coal Mine Production, stay wide coal column to cause the substantial amounts of wasting of resources simultaneously.For improving recovery ratio, stay thin coal pillar, protect table component protection coal pillar by anchor cable net and w steel band, but still the features such as the string bag, anchor pole failure damage, coal column generation large deformation destruction occurs in lane side, has a strong impact on mine safety production.

Detailed description of the invention
For making the technical solution of the utility model clearly, clearly, it is described further in conjunction with 1 to 2 pair, accompanying drawing detailed description of the invention of the present utility model:
The bracing means of thin coal pillar between a kind of tunnel, described thin coal pillar 3 is arranged over top board 1, it is connected with base plate 2, described bracing means includes anchor cable 4 and protects table panels 5, and described thin coal pillar offers anchor hole 9, described in protect table panels and be arranged at thin coal pillar both sides, anchor cable 4 runs through anchor hole and arranges, and anchor cable two ends protrude from and protect table panels, anchor cable two ends add cydariform pallet 6, and cydariform pallet 6 is fixed by rigging 7.Cydariform pallet has yielding automatically effect, and protection table steel plate local pressure is too high causes failure of cable, and because coal helps surface irregularity, usual steel plate back needs the filling back of the body real, this allows pressure device, it is to avoid the tedious work such as steel plate back filling
Anchor hole diameter on thin coal pillar is 15-40mm, and described anchor cable diameter is 10-30mm, and anchor cable diameter is adaptive with anchor hole.
Protect the steel plate of the comprcssive strength that table panels is thickness 10~30mm, wide 2~4m, high 2~5m.The face guard size required for size choosing according to coal column.Protecting table panels is rectangular shape, every piece of firm plate area 4-20m2, and this large-area steel plate is as protecting table component, it is possible to accelerate speed of application.
Anchor hole has five, be distributed in two, coal column top, one, middle part, two, bottom in birdeye arrange, steel plate is provided with hole, 5 corresponding with anchor hole.This hole arrangement can make firm plate have stiff stability, and phase comparison eye is arranged, this mode reduces anchor hole operation, saves the support materials such as anchor cable.
Grouting layer 8 it is filled with between anchor cable and anchor hole.Grouting layer is grout layer or chemical consolidation material layer.
The purpose of this utility model is to be in that to reinforce fast and effectively thin coal pillar, when concrete field-hardened is constructed, boring anchor hole on thin coal pillar, bore dia 15-40mm (determined by anchor cable specification by anchor hole diameter, generally require that anchor hole diameter is more than anchor cable 10-30mm), and penetrate thin coal pillar;Wearing anchor cable in hole, anchor cable diameter selects 15-30mm (lateral restriction applied as required determines anchor cable specification);Cement injection in hole, makes broken coalmass crevasse healing;Table component steel plate, steel plate thickness 10-30mm, wide 2-4m, high 2-5m (selecting required plate size according to the size of coal column) are protected in installation;Drum shape is installed and allows pressure pallet, then rigging is installed, it is desirable to improve the pretightning force at anchor cable both ends, make steel plate that coal column both sides to provide bigger lateral restriction, it is ensured that coal column is stable.
In this utility model, it is flexibly that anchor hole is arranged, if it is excessive by side force to protect table component somewhere, in order to prevent, local pressure is excessive causes anchor cable damage inactivation, can this stress higher near increase anchor hole, and anchor cable is installed, strengthens and protect table dynamics.
